
The Bachelor of Information and Communication Technology Education (BICTE) is an undergraduate program that combines the fields of education and ICT (Information and Communication Technology). It aims to equip students with a solid foundation in ICT concepts and practical skills while also preparing them to teach and integrate ICT in educational settings. This program is designed to develop professionals who can work as ICT educators, trainers, and facilitators, especially in schools, colleges, and other educational institutions. Graduates from this program play a key role in bridging the gap between technology and education, enhancing digital literacy and promoting technology-based teaching and learning.
Scope of BICTE
Graduates of the BICTE program have a wide range of career opportunities in both education and technology sectors. The scope of BICTE includes:
- Teaching and Training:
- ICT teachers or educators in schools, colleges, and training centers.
- Trainers in digital literacy and ICT for various educational and corporate environments.
- Curriculum Design:
- Involvement in the development and integration of ICT in educational curricula.
- Designing technology-driven instructional materials and e-learning resources.
- Educational Technology Specialist:
- Working as an educational technologist or ICT coordinator, helping schools and institutions adopt and implement digital learning tools.
- E-Learning and EdTech Development:
- Developing online courses, e-learning platforms, and educational software.
- Providing technical support in educational institutions.
- ICT Consultancy in Education:
- Consulting schools and educational organizations on the integration of ICT tools, resources, and infrastructure.
- Higher Studies and Research:
- Pursuing further studies in fields like educational technology, ICT management, or a Master’s in Information Technology or Education.
Key Competencies Developed in BICTE Graduates
- ICT Proficiency:
- Strong foundation in computer hardware, software, programming, networking, and cybersecurity.
- Competence in using and teaching office applications, databases, multimedia tools, and other educational software.
- Pedagogical Skills:
- Understanding of educational theories, methodologies, and strategies for teaching ICT.
- Ability to develop lesson plans, instructional materials, and assessment tools that integrate ICT in education.
- Digital Literacy and E-Learning Expertise:
- Skills to design and implement digital learning environments, including virtual classrooms and e-learning platforms.
- Expertise in developing digital resources such as online courses, interactive content, and multimedia resources.
- Problem-Solving and Critical Thinking:
- Ability to troubleshoot and solve technology-related issues in the classroom.
- Critical thinking skills to analyze and select appropriate ICT tools for educational purposes.
- Leadership and Management:
- Ability to manage ICT resources and lead digital transformation initiatives in educational institutions.
- Leadership skills to train and mentor other teachers in integrating ICT into their teaching.
- Ethical Use of ICT:
- Understanding the ethical implications of ICT in education, including privacy, digital citizenship, and responsible use of technology.
